1. BACK UP AND RESTORE

That’s right, you’re going to want to back up your old iPhone after you have your new iPhone 12 in hand, so the backup is as up to date as it can possibly be. You can back up via iCloud, in iTunes or the Finder.

For a Mac backup (macOS Catalina): Connect your old iPhone to your Mac, open a new Finder window, and select your iPhone in the left column in the Locations section.
